Studies on pharmaceutical ethnobotany in Arrabida Natural Park (Portugal)
M H Novais1, I Santos, S Mendes
1Departamento de Ecologia da Universidade de Evora, Evora, Portugal.
Journal of Ethnopharmacology
|July 6, 2004
Abstract:
An ethnobotanical survey was carried out in Arrabida Natural Park, a Portuguese Protected Area in the Southwest of the Iberian Peninsula, with an area of 10,820 ha. Working with 72 local people, data on medicinal uses of 156 taxa, belonging to 56 botanical families, were obtained and presented, of which 214 uses corresponding to 81 taxa were previously unreported.

Methods for Studying Drug Absorption: In situ
In situ experiments, such as the Doluisio method and Single-Pass Perfusion technique, provide critical insights into drug uptake by simulating in vivo conditions for drug absorption.
The Doluisio method involves perfusing a prepared segment of a rat's small intestine with a solution of radiolabeled drug and a non-absorbable marker. Methods for Studying Drug Absorption: In vitro
In vitro experiments are crucial for understanding the transport and absorption of drugs through biological materials. These studies employ varied methods such as the diffusion cell method, the everted sac technique, and the everted ring technique.
